As per the thread title, I had been considering replacing the coolant in my February 2011 B8 S4 mileage is low, 26K!
Anyway, I have been testing the ph level at every service using coolant test strips and checking the freezing point using the same strips and a refractometer. It still seems to be okay so up until now I have left the G12 or maybe G12 plus in it.
At this years service, I noticed a few spots of evaporated coolant on the engine under cover - looking upwards leads me to believe that it is coming from the engine end of the coolant hose that connects to the radiator lower RHS - and I'm guessing that the reason for this slight leak is that this pipe would have been flexed when the lock carrier was pulled out to the service position when I replaced the supercharger and auxiliary belts last summer/autumn.
So, I've ordered in a couple of new O-rings and springs and replacing them will mean dumping the coolant out - so this seems like the best time to replace it.
I'm planning on buying maybe 15 litres of G12EVO premixed, as buying conc G13EVO is not possible in smaller than 60 litre containers.
So, my question is, what coolant are people using when they replace watch was loaded in at the factory?
One curious thing I noticed when I looked at a G12plus and a G13 1.5 litre of conc, the G13 conc container defines G13 as being a "filled for life" coolant additive, that comment is not on the G12plus conc container, which seems strange when it seems to be G13 that gave rise to the addition of Silicate pouches in coolant header tanks.
I've got a coolant vac kit and ordered in a couple of supercharger heat exchanger plugs as I read that sometimes they are tricky to remove and reuse.
